As Gen Z hunts for career fire starters, these are the best MBA programs landing grads $150K+ jobs in tech and consulting
Gen Z is often questioning the value of higher education, but a new ranking from LinkedIn reveals that top MBA programs like Stanford and Harvard are still paving the way for lucrative careers, with graduates landing jobs that pay over $150K in tech and consulting. This is significant as it highlights the enduring appeal of prestigious programs in a changing job market, reassuring students that investing in an MBA can lead to substantial financial rewards.

Tariffs on imported sugar to hit liberals, Gen Z even MAHA where it hurts: organic food
NegativeFinancial Markets
The recent tariffs on imported sugar are set to significantly impact the organic food market, with the Organic Trade Association predicting a 30% increase in prices. This is particularly concerning for manufacturers who rely on imported organic sugar, as over 90% of their supply comes from abroad. The rise in costs could hit consumers hard, especially younger generations like Gen Z who prioritize organic products. This situation highlights the broader implications of trade policies on everyday goods and the potential strain on those advocating for healthier food options.

China Magnet Exports to US Slip Even as Overall Shipments Rise
NegativeFinancial Markets
In August, China's exports of rare-earth magnets to the US saw a decline, despite a general increase in overall shipments. This drop is significant as it highlights ongoing tensions in trade relations, particularly in the tech and manufacturing sectors where these magnets are crucial. The easing of restrictions by Beijing has not translated into improved exports for this specific category, raising concerns about future supply and pricing.
